Gujarat Alkalies & Chemicals Ltd (GACL) is a state-promoted commodity chemicals company trading at a market cap of ₹4,450 Cr with a price-to-book of 0.86x, reflecting depressed profitability — the company posted a negative PE of -1846x and a 3-year average ROE of -2%. While FY25 revenue grew 7% YoY to ₹4,073 Cr and net profit turned marginally positive at ₹15.8 Cr (vs a loss of ₹132 Cr in FY24), the recovery remains nascent against a backdrop of heavy capex commitments and weak interest coverage.

Bull Case 8
  • Stock trades at 0.86x book value, offering a margin of safety for a Gujarat Government-promoted company with significant fixed assets
  • FY25 revenue grew 7% YoY to ₹4,073 Cr, reversing a 3-year compounded sales decline of -1% and indicating demand stabilisation
  • Net profit swung from a loss of ₹132 Cr in FY24 to a profit of ₹15.8 Cr in FY25, a turnaround reflected in TTM profit growth of 96%
  • Promoter holding increased by 1.00% in the latest quarter, signalling state-government confidence in the business outlook
  • Dividend yield of 2.59% provides income support even during a weak earnings cycle
  • Board approved ₹1,029 Cr in expansion projects including biofuel/coal boilers at Vadodara and Dahej, plus a new 700 MTPD Caustic Evaporation Unit — one of India's largest — positioning for volume-led recovery
  • Expansion into value-added products (High Purity Hydrogen Peroxide, ₹81 Cr investment in 3 new downstream plants) signals a strategic shift up the value chain from pure commodity chemicals
  • Renewable energy buildout of 177.6 MW (62.7 MW + 72 MW + 42.9 MW hybrid) under captive SPV should reduce long-term power costs, which stood at ₹1,219 Cr in FY25
Bear Case 8
  • Negative PE ratio of -1846x reflects near-zero profitability; FY25 net profit of ₹15.8 Cr on revenue of ₹4,073 Cr implies a net margin of just 0.4%
  • 3-year average ROE of -2% and last-year ROE of approximately 0% indicate the company is barely earning its cost of equity
  • Low interest coverage ratio with interest costs rising from ₹44.6 Cr in FY24 to ₹50.5 Cr in FY25, while operating profit was only ₹360 Cr before depreciation of ₹392 Cr
  • Depreciation of ₹392 Cr in FY25 nearly matches EBITDA of ₹452 Cr, leaving minimal free cash flow for debt reduction
  • Power and fuel costs of ₹1,219 Cr in FY25 (30% of revenue) expose the company to energy price volatility in a commodity business
  • 5-year compounded profit growth is negligible (not meaningfully calculable) given the FY24 loss of ₹132 Cr and thin FY25 profit, indicating structural margin fragility
  • Stock has delivered a 3-year CAGR of -3%, underperforming both broader indices and chemical sector peers during the same period
  • Large capex commitments (₹1,029 Cr expansion approved) risk further balance sheet stress if caustic soda pricing remains weak, given already low interest coverage

Company Information

Incorporated in 1973, Gujarat Alkalies and Chemicals Ltd is promoted by the Government of Gujarat, with promoter-group shareholding of 47.28% as of FY26. The company operates manufacturing complexes at Vadodara and Dahej, Gujarat, and has 50+ years of operating history in chlor-alkali and allied chemicals.[1]
